Cowes Classic 2016 – Sunday 4th Sept

If you’re in Cowes or Torquay this weekend, head over to catch the thrills and spills of the Cowes -Torquay-Cowes Race. Around 20 boats are expected to be in the line-up to take on the challenge of the 200 mile classic, long recognised as one of powerboating’s toughest races. The race starts at 9.30 am from Cowes, with boats expected to arrive at Torquay from 10.30/11am onwards for the fastest entries. Presentations will be made at Haldon Pier, Torquay at 12.30, with a parade at 1.30pm, followed by the race start back to Cowes at 2pm. Podium presentation at Cowes at 4pm.
